4-[3,4,5-Trihydroxy-6-(hydroxymethyl)oxan-2-yl]oxypyridine-3-carboxylic acid
| Internal ID | 5844853b-e21d-4c7d-9bba-bd84b658c7f2 |
| Taxonomy | Organic oxygen compounds > Organooxygen compounds > Carbohydrates and carbohydrate conjugates > Glycosyl compounds > O-glycosyl compounds |
| IUPAC Name | 4-[3,4,5-trihydroxy-6-(hydroxymethyl)oxan-2-yl]oxypyridine-3-carboxylic acid |
| SMILES (Canonical) | C1=CN=CC(=C1OC2C(C(C(C(O2)CO)O)O)O)C(=O)O |
| SMILES (Isomeric) | C1=CN=CC(=C1OC2C(C(C(C(O2)CO)O)O)O)C(=O)O |
| InChI | InChI=1S/C12H15NO8/c14-4-7-8(15)9(16)10(17)12(21-7)20-6-1-2-13-3-5(6)11(18)19/h1-3,7-10,12,14-17H,4H2,(H,18,19) |
| InChI Key | LRAYZXVBPSCDCZ-UHFFFAOYSA-N |
| Popularity | 0 references in papers |
| Molecular Formula | C12H15NO8 |
| Molecular Weight | 301.25 g/mol |
| Exact Mass | 301.07976644 g/mol |
| Topological Polar Surface Area (TPSA) | 150.00 Ų |
| XlogP | -1.80 |
